image-position:在 Qt 4.3 及更高版本中,可以使用相对或绝对位置指定图像图像位置的对齐 spacing:控件中的内部间距 subcontrol-origin:父元素中子控件的原始矩形 subcontrol-position:subcontrol-origin 指定的原始矩形内子控件的对齐方式。 button-layout:QDialogButtonBox 或 QMessageBox 中按钮的布局 messagebox-text-int...
如果指定了svg,则图像将缩放为内容矩形的大小。在子控件上设置image属性会隐式设置子控件的宽度和高度(除非SVG中的图像)。此属性仅用于子控件。例: QSpinBox::down-button { image: url(:/D:/a.png) } 7、image-position:图片位置,仅用于子控件。例: QSpinBox::down-button { image: url(:/D:/a.png);...
如果同时指定了 background-image 和 borimage ,那么 border-image 会绘制在 background-image 上。 此外,image 属性可以用来在 border-image 上绘制一个图片。如果使用 image 指定的图片大小与部件的大小不匹配,那么它不会平铺或者拉伸。图片的对齐方式可以使用 image-position 属性来设置。 3. 子控件 对于一些复杂...
image-position alignme nt 在Qt 4.3 及以后的版本中,图片的位置可使用相对定位和绝对定位来设置。 left Length 如果 position (位置)是relative(相对的)(默认值),则将某個 subcontrol (子控件)向右移动一定距离。 如果 position 是absolute(绝对的),则left属性指定的是这個子控件的左边线与亲代部件的左边线...
image-position: right center;\ border-image: url(:/images/button_press.png) 3 10 3 10;\ border-top: 3px transparent;\ border-bottom: 3px transparent;\ border-right: 10px transparent;\ border-left: 10px transparent;\ }"); qDebug()<<"11111111111"<<endl; ...
QPushButton{/*按钮上图标下文字*/text-align:bottom;image-position:top;color:#666666;border:none;image:url(:xxxxx.png);}QPushButton{/*按钮自适应拉伸背景*/border-width:2px15px2px15px;border-image:url(:/resource/icon/button_nomal.png)215215repeat stretch;color:#3288E8;}QPushButton{/*按钮选...
&ImageManager::setImagePosition); connect(m_fileMonitor, &FileMonitorMgr::sigAddFiles, ProjectWin::getInstance(), &ProjectWin::slotUpdatePicTree); //添加新的任务开机节点 connect(m_fileMonitor, &FileMonitorMgr::sigAddFilesPos, m_imgMgr, &ImageManager::addNewPicResort); // connect(m_fileMonit...
第一种方法,利用Qss的setStyleSheet设置背景图片,可以通过background-image属性添加图片路径,实现背景图片设置。使用background-position:center;实现居中显示,background-repeat:no-repeat;实现不重复显示。同时可选择background-repeat:repeat;实现重复显示。代码示例如下:QWidget#widgetWinPic { background-...
QPushButton::menu-indicator:open{image:url(:/misc/down_arrow_2);subcontrol-position:right center;subcontrol-origin:padding;}QPushButton::menu-indicator:closed{image:url(:/misc/right_arrow_2);subcontrol-position:right center;subcontrol-origin:padding;} ...
2.1 设置Qt Widget背景图片(Setting Qt Widget Background Image) 在Qt中,我们可以通过多种方式设置Widget的背景图片,下面我们将详细介绍这些方法。 方法一:使用QPalette QPalette是Qt中用于管理颜色的类,我们可以通过它来设置背景图片。以下是一个简单的例子: ...